Mohammed In Denmark

Thursday, February 09, 2006

This week, throughout the Islamic world, embassies were attacked, flags burned, and journalists threatened over a series of satirical cartoons published by a Danish newspaper. Kurt Andersen and Professor Azar Nafisi discuss why the row is less about the power of an image than freedom of speech.
